ABSTRACT
A novel [2]rotaxane, containing pyrene and perylene bisimide as both stoppers and photoactive units, has been prepared. The shuttling of the
protonated macrocycle switched the energy transfer (EN) from a pyrene moiety to a perylene moiety, which resulted in changes of fluorescence
of the perylene moiety.
